A nongovernmental organization says a quarter of a million Afghan children need education, food and homes after being forcibly returned from Pakistan
A quarter of a million Afghan children need education, food and homes after being forcibly returned from Pakistan, a nongovernmental organization said Thursday. Pakistan is cracking down on foreigners it alleges are in the country illegally, including 1.7 million Afghans. It insists the campaign is not directed against Afghans specifically, but they make up most of the foreigners in the country. More than 520,000 Afghans have left Pakistan since last October.
In Pakistan, more than two-thirds of these children had been attending school, it said. An additional obstacle facing child returnees is the ban on girls attending school beyond sixth grade in Afghanistan. Arshad Malik, Save the Children country director for Afghanistan, said the return of so many people was creating an additional strain on already overstretched resources. “Many undocumented Afghan children were born in Pakistan,” he said. “Afghanistan is not the place they call home.
